The Carlyle named its bar Bemelmans Bar after Ludwig Bemelman - author and illustrator of the Madeline books, whose murals of animals are found frolicking whimsically on these bar walls. This delightful tongue-in-cheek daubing provides a foil for what could be perceived as a palpable bastion of post-war bourgeoisie dissipation. We are talking leather banquettes, nickel-trimmed glass tables, gold leaf ceilings and white jacketed waiters. This bar menu is notable for having ex Per Se's Brian Van Flandern put his stamp on it. A Dutch drinks company ranked him the No. 2 bartender in the world, in homage to his Flaming Dutchman. Sounds like a drink from the Pirates of the Caribbean movie but it is delicious.
